Zinkensdamm Hotell & Vandrarhem is where community spirit, everyday Stockholm life, and unfiltered simplicity come together, offering a stay that feels grounded, social, and refreshingly honest in a city often defined by polish.

Located in the heart of SΓΆdermalm, just steps from green parks and the city's western waterfront, Zinkensdamm does not present itself as a hotel of aspiration. It presents itself as a place of participation. Arrival immediately signals that this is a shared space. The surrounding streets feel residential and lived in, shaped by joggers heading toward Tantolunden, families moving through daily routines, and locals passing through. The building itself feels open and functional, intentionally approachable, signaling that what matters here is not luxury signaling but connection, affordability, and presence. Step inside and the atmosphere reinforces that message. Interiors are straightforward, bright, and social, designed to support conversation, movement, and coexistence. Public spaces feel communal. There is an ease to the layout that invites people to gather naturally, whether that's sharing a table, planning a day out, or simply resting between walks. Guest accommodations span both traditional hotel rooms and hostel-style lodging, but the philosophy remains consistent throughout. Expect clean, practical rooms that prioritize rest, clarity, and function. Beds are comfortable and well-kept, designed to support real sleep. Furnishings are simple and durable, chosen to withstand frequent use. Windows often open onto greenery, parkland, or quiet residential streets, grounding the experience in SΓΆdermalm's everyday texture. Bathrooms are clean, efficient, and well maintained, whether private or shared, reinforcing the idea that comfort here is measured by reliability. What defines Zinkensdamm Hotell & Vandrarhem is its social sincerity. Public areas encourage interaction. The cafΓ© and dining spaces feel like neighborhood meeting points. Conversations happen easily, between travelers, locals, students, and families, creating an atmosphere that feels democratic and alive. Service is friendly, direct, and genuinely helpful. Staff engage with ease and clarity, offering guidance rooted in local familiarity. Step outside and SΓΆdermalm reveals a side of Stockholm that feels open and generous. Parks, waterfront paths, swimming spots, playgrounds, and casual eateries are all close at hand. Metro access nearby makes reaching Gamla Stan, Norrmalm, and other districts effortless, but many guests find themselves lingering nearby, drawn to the area's relaxed rhythm. Zinkensdamm Hotell & Vandrarhem is ideal for travelers who want Stockholm to feel human, accessible, and shared, a stay that emphasizes belonging over polish and experience over presentation.

Zinkensdamm sits within a part of SΓΆdermalm shaped by public life, green space, and social integration.

The Zinkensdamm area developed as a residential and recreational zone. Its proximity to parks like Tantolunden and waterfront promenades shaped it as a place for leisure, community gathering, and everyday movement. Unlike neighborhoods designed around commerce or tourism, this area evolved to support daily life: children playing, residents exercising, families gathering outdoors. Buildings here were constructed with practicality in mind, emphasizing access, light, and proximity to shared spaces. Zinkensdamm Hotell & Vandrarhem reflects this lineage. Its design and function align with the area's social character. A lesser-known aspect of this neighborhood is how intentionally it resisted privatization of space. Parks remained open, waterfronts accessible, and public amenities prioritized. This philosophy is mirrored inside the property. Spaces are shared, flexible, and inclusive. Rather than separating guests by status or accommodation type, the hotel fosters coexistence. Hostel guests, families, solo travelers, and groups move through the same spaces, reinforcing a sense of collective presence. This approach aligns with broader Scandinavian values of social equity and accessibility. Hospitality here is not about exclusivity; it is about participation. The property's longevity speaks to this success. Zinkensdamm has remained relevant not by chasing trends but by serving a consistent need: affordable, reliable, community-oriented lodging that reflects Stockholm's everyday life. Staying here places you inside a model of urban hospitality rooted in usefulness and openness, where comfort is defined by trust, cleanliness, and shared respect.

Zinkensdamm works best when you let SΓΆdermalm's outdoor life and neighborhood rhythm guide your days.

Begin your mornings with a walk through Tantolunden, letting greenery, water, and open sky orient your senses before the city fully activates. Grab breakfast at the hotel cafΓ© or a nearby local spot, sharing space with residents heading into their day. Late mornings are ideal for swimming at nearby bathing spots in warmer months or strolling waterfront paths that reveal Stockholm from a quieter, more personal angle. Midday, return to the property to rest, plan, or connect with fellow travelers. The communal environment makes it easy to exchange ideas, recommendations, or simply enjoy shared presence. In the afternoon, use the nearby metro to reach Gamla Stan's historic streets or Norrmalm's cultural venues, knowing that returning to SΓΆdermalm will feel like coming back to a calmer register of the city. As evening approaches, dine casually nearby, choosing places that reflect neighborhood life. Afterward, walk back through parks and residential streets that feel relaxed and secure, the city's energy softened by distance from its commercial core. On your final morning, linger outdoors one last time. Sit in the park, watch families and joggers pass, and notice how different Stockholm feels from this vantage point.
